Understanding Asset-Based Valuation: A Comprehensive Guide

Asset-based valuation gives a core approach for calculating the value of a organization. This method focuses on the adjusted asset value, which represents the variation between a firm's total assets and its total liabilities. Essentially, it’s a view at what a business would be priced if its assets were converted at their current value and all debts were settled . While simpler to perform than some other valuation methods, it's often most suitable for companies with substantial tangible assets or in situations involving dissolution.

A Property Assessment Approach: A Financial Institution's Viewpoint

From a lender's standpoint, the resource appraisal approach serves as a critical risk mitigation tool. It allows them to calculate the potential loan amount a applicant can receive, ensuring the institution can repossess its funds in the event of default. This system typically involves examining the present market value of the security, often using comparable sales data and expert assessments. Lenders focus a prudent assessment to account for potential property shifts and maintain a adequate cushion. Finally, the resource assessment approach helps financial institutions control exposure and safeguard their capital position.

Methods for Asset Valuation in Lending – A Detailed Breakdown

When granting loans , lenders must have a thorough evaluation of the worth of the properties being offered as assurance. This appraisal can be carried out through several techniques . Common processes include the cost approach, which calculates the commercial mortgage lenders reproduction cost less wear and tear; the market approach, which analyzes recent exchanges of comparable assets ; and the cash flow approach, which forecasts future returns based on the asset's potential to produce income . Furthermore, lenders often employ professional valuers and consider third-party assessments to confirm an reliable evaluation of asset price and mitigate risk .

Net Asset Method

The net asset approach is a process for calculating the worth of a business by concentrating on the gap between its holdings and its debts . Simply put , it requires a thorough inspection of the company's balance sheet to identify the fair market value of each physical asset, such as real estate , machinery , and inventory , less any outstanding liabilities like debts and payables. Key concepts include book value , which represents the sum that would be given back to shareholders if the firm were shut down and its property sold at their book values .

Demystifying Asset Valuation : Techniques & Recommended Procedures

Determining the accurate value of an property can appear complex , but understanding the fundamental methods makes it far more manageable. Common approaches include cost costing, which assesses the investment to replace or recreate the item; the sales approach, analyzing similar sales to set a guide; and the income approach, projecting future profits to arrive at a estimated value. Optimal practices involve rigorous due diligence , employing qualified experts , and considering a variety of elements impacting the asset's future yield . A thorough assessment improves the reliability of the appraisal and lessens the exposure associated with any investment judgment.
